The invention belongs to the technical field of underwater weapons and ocean engineering, and particularly relates to an AUV (autonomous underwater vehicle) propulsion system which comprises a watertight motor, a propulsion propeller and a fairing, the watertight motor is mounted at the front end of an autonomous underwater vehicle shell, the propulsion propeller is mounted at the front end of the watertight motor, the fairing is fixed on the periphery of the watertight motor, and a watertight closed space is formed between the fairing and the autonomous underwater vehicle shell. The watertight motor in the AUV propulsion system is designed and used, and a propulsion motor can be completely watertight and has thrust characteristics. Different from other motors, the propulsion motor is completely watertight when applied to the AUV propulsion system and can be applied to similar propulsion system motor design occasions by the aid of stepped pressure drop dynamic sealing technology.
